The Benefits of a Self Cleaning Vacuum
Self-cleaning vacuums make life easier for busy families. It takes care of all dust and debris, and lets you set an agenda for your floors. You can also save time and money.
Most robot vacuums can connect to Wi-Fi. This lets you control them from any location. Some robot vacuums are equipped with clever features like room mapping and no-go zones.
How do they work?
Sensor technology is utilized by many robot vacuums to determine the size and shape of a room. They also make use of infrared signals for detecting doors, walls, and furniture. This helps them designate rooms and create efficient cleaning routes. This feature is particularly beneficial for homes with multiple rooms and huge floors. Moreover, it helps prevent collisions with furniture and walls. The self-cleaning vacuums also keep track of their position so that they don't get lost or unable to find their way home.
Another benefit of robots is that they can help you save lots of time. They can be controlled with your tablet or smartphone and run according to a schedule that you have set. This is perfect for busy families who wish to reduce time while maintaining a clean house when they return. Some models allow you to activate the system while you're away on vacation or work.
Robot vacuums are great in keeping floors clean, but they cannot remove dirt that is embedded in carpets or rug. Additionally, they tend to neglect dust near thresholds and baseboards. Additionally, their obstacle-avoidance sensors are not as effective as those used in upright and cordless vacuums. You should clean up prior to beginning the machine, and create no-go zones in areas where toys, socks or other objects can become strung up.
Many best value robot vacuum vacuums utilize sensor navigation systems to avoid obstructions and return to docking stations when the battery is low. A docking station can be used to store a bag or filter that requires to be replaced. They can be programmed to run either on a timer, or with voice commands.
The most expensive robotic vacuum cleaners have a feature known as dToF Laser Navigation, which makes use of a laser scan to locate and navigate around objects. It can detect objects that are up to 14 feet and can detect small spaces, such as chair legs and under furniture. It is also able to recognize different surfaces and detect stains on the floor. It is more precise and can be used for different flooring options including tile, carpet and wood.

Robot vacuums and mops utilize a variety of sensors to map the space in which they operate. Infrared sensors identify obstacles and help them avoid collisions and cameras and laser sensors collect images and data to create an image of the environment. This information is used to create an efficient cleaning path that reduces wasted movement and ensures uniform coverage across all areas.
Smart vacuums and mop are designed to save energy by intelligently optimizing and navigating their cleaning routes. They can be switched to a low-power mode if necessary, reducing energy consumption. They can be connected to Wi-Fi networks and allow them to be controlled remotely through an app or voice commands.
Apps created by manufacturers let you control various smart vacuums and mops via your tablet or smartphone. The app lets you schedule cleaning sessions, change mapping and navigation settings and check the status of your battery. Some robots are able to observe their own performance and send you alerts if there is any issue.
